Wireless packet core market revenues grew 9 percent over
the last year during the first quarter of 2012.
Sales were driven by the evolved packet core segment of
the market as service providers accelerated the deployment of LTE networks.
The most powerful driver for the Wireless Packet Core
market today is LTE,” said Chris DePuy, analyst of Wireless Packet Core at
Dell’Oro Group.
Service providers are experiencing significant growth in
LTE subscribers, leading to an accelerated pace of deployment for evolved
packet core equipment. There is a lot of change in the vendor landscape
as demonstrated by Cisco’s success in expanding beyond its traditional North
American territory. We also expect other technologies beyond LTE to
propel sales of Wireless Packet Core such as WiFi,” DePuy added.
